AI Findings Summary

Critical

The telemetry indicates a significant exposure event impacting NVIDIA, with over 4.4 million total events recorded between July 2025 and June 2026. A substantial portion of these events, over 3.7 million, are classified as historical data breaches, while over 727,000 are active infostealer logs. The data suggests a widespread compromise affecting approximately 60,000 employees and over 4.3 million clients. The primary malware families observed are Redline, Rhadamanthys, and LummaC2, all known for credential theft. The targeted services are predominantly related to NVIDIA's login and account creation infrastructure, indicating a focus on account takeover and credential harvesting.
